Arachnophobia Mode useless?
Hi, I am a huge fan of HL and I have always been really scared of spiders (I even have to tell myself to stay calm when I hover over them in the menu). I bought the deluxe version so that I could play on Feburary 7th and since then, all spiders that are required to kill for 100% have been killed by friends or family. As you can guess I am very thankful for the devs to introduce an Arachnophobia Mode but somehow it doesnt really cure my fear. I believe the fact that the enemy is supposed to be a spider is enough for my brain to panic. Even the spiderwebs are enough to make me go nuts. Am I weird or are there people who can relate?
Question from user Do-not-ask_ at HogwartsLegacyGaming at reddit.
Answer:
For me personally I think its that the spiders still make the noises with arachnophobia mode on. But in the wild its still bearable for me. It when you have to go into dens or doing jackdaws quest that was difficult for me. I had to take a break to calm myself after every spider group and saved afterwards to make sure I didnt have to go back. Though the amount of spiders in this game is ridiculous. There are so many other monster enemies they could have added to balance it. And then when people complained about the spiders instead of lowering the spawn rate in the wild but only added the arachnophobia mode as if we were over reacting about it. Like I get the spider dens are a part of the game but they dont need to span in the wild as far as Im concerned.
